Our mission is to equip leaders to SOAR in their faith, family, friendships, finances, and fitness through a community where they feel connected and valued. We recognize the Bible as the inspired Word of God and the final authority in every aspect of our lives. “Your Word is a lamp to my feet and a light to my path.” (Psalm 119:105) Eagles Nest Church is a non-denominational, multi-generational church based in North Fulton, GA. There are two primary reasons we call ourselves Eagles Nest. First, eagles are used in the Bible to represent strength, courage and leadership. Eagles are mentioned in Exodus 19:4, Deuteronomy 32:11, Job 39:27, Psalm 103:5, and Isaiah 40:31, to name a few. At Eagles Nest, we want to help you develop your leadership potential. Secondly, every eagle needs a nest. The Nest is the place where eagles are fed, encouraged, and inspired. That’s what we do. We feed you the word of God. We encourage you when times get tough, and we inspire you to do great things for God! If you’re looking for a church that will help you reach your potential, then look no further. Coming to America (At the Movies Series)

Coming To America uses humor and heart to explore the serious issue of immigration through the lens of faith. Pastor Lee Jenkins draws parallels between Prince Akeem's journey in the movie and the biblical call to love and welcome the foreigner. The message challenges believers to prioritize their theology over politics and to treat immigrants with compassion, dignity, and love.

Verses:


Leviticus 19:33–34, Deuteronomy 8:18, Exodus 22:21, Deuteronomy 10:18–19, Zechariah 7:10, Matthew 25:35, Matthew 2:13–15, Philippians 2:6–7

Key Points/Topics Covered:

  • Understanding the biblical mandate to love and welcome immigrants
  • Drawing lessons from the movie Coming To America to highlight spiritual truths
  • Recognizing that all Americans are descendants of immigrants
  • Prioritizing theology and faith over political ideologies
  • Emulating Christ's humility and servant-heartedness

Main Takeaways:


- God commands us to treat immigrants as family, with love and dignity.
- Our theology must shape our view of people more than our political affiliations.
- Jesus himself was a refugee, and how we treat the foreigner reflects how we treat Him.
